from Run The Red Light EP, released 01 January 2010
Produced by Gabriel Wilson & Run The Red Light. Engineered by Nolan Russom and Gabriel Wilson. Recorded at Supernatural Sound Studios, Oregon City, USA. Additional recording at Echo Sound Studios, Vancouver, Canada. Additional engineering and editing by Toby Hulse. Mixed by Craig Alvin in Nashville, USA, assisted by Geoff Piller. Mastered by Dave Collins at Collins Audio, Los Angeles, USA. Run The Red Light is: Toby Hulse (Vocals, Guitar). Ben Hulse (Drums). Mark Lazeski (Bass, Vocals). Brendan Stoneman (Guitar). String arrangements and keyboards by Gabriel Wilson. All songs by Hulse/Hulse/Lazeski/Stoneman/Wilson, except "Side" and "A Million Voices Stronger" by Hulse/Hulse/Lazeski/Stoneman. Art Direction & Design: Ben Hulse. Photography: Brenndan Laird. Copyright © 2009 Run The Red Light (SOCAN/BMI)/Worship Circus Music (ASCAP).
